Job description

Description

To participate in a remote work arrangement, employees must reside in the United States. No remote work arrangement will be considered for working from outside the United States.

If you are a current employee, faculty or adjunct instructor at Herzing University (not a Contractor or temporary employee through a staffing agency), please click here to log in to UKG and then navigate to Menu > Myself > My Company > View Opportunities to apply using the internal application process.

Hours:

A 40-hour a week schedule will be determined by business needs, Monday through Friday, between 8AM and 5PM CST, with one late night scheduled until 7PM.

Job Details

This is a customer service position assisting a diverse student population. You will primarily support students receiving funding through Herzing University community partnerships by providing personalized guidance on financial aid options. This role is ideal for someone who thrives in a fast-paced, student-focused environment and excels at clear, proactive communication. Financial Aid Advisors receive onboarding support through our On-the-Job Training Program and have opportunities for growth via our Career Pathways.

Qualifications
  • Great customer service skills and experience.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office including Word, Excel, and Outlook.
  • Experience or knowledge of Student Information Systems (CampusNexus & Regent preferred).
  • Title IV administration experience preferred.
  • Bachelor's degree preferred.
Pay and Benefits

Compensation is based on qualifications, experience, and circumstances. The hourly pay range is $19.56 to $28.85. We offer a comprehensive benefits package, including a tuition waiver and reimbursement, health insurance, paid time off, and a retirement plan with company match.
